Question

Let $A=\left\{(x, y) \in \mathbb{R}^{2}: y \geq 0,2 x \leq y \leq \sqrt{4-(x-1)^{2}}\right\}$ and

$$ B=\left\{(x, y) \in \mathbb{R} \times \mathbb{R}: 0 \leq y \leq \min \left\{2 x, \sqrt{4-(x-1)^{2}}\right\}\right\} \text {. } $$.

Then the ratio of the area of A to the area of B is

$\frac{\pi}{\pi+1}$
$\frac{\pi-1}{\pi+1}$
$\frac{\pi}{\pi-1}$
$\frac{\pi+1}{\pi-1}$
